Applied research keeps focusing on the substitution possibilities of peat in cultivation substrates by some other components. A good alternative is the use of waste bark, especially from pine tree and spruce. Bark has very valuable physical characteristics, porosity, water permeability and low volumetric mass. However its easy desiccation and low aptitude to nutrients absorption are problems. These stress factors can easily be eliminated by applying special stockage slow release fertilisers and quality hydroabsorbents. Our department has successfully been focusing on this problem for several years.
